Actions
None for HP Integrity NonStop NS5000 or NS16000 series servers.
For an IOAM enclosure in an HP Integrity NonStop NS14000 or NS1000 system only, these
actions are available:
Configure Power Source as AC
Sets the Configuration > Power Supply attribute value for this power supply unit to AC. You must
be logged on as super.super to perform this action.
Configure Power Source as UPS
Sets the Power Source attribute value for this power supply unit to UPS. You must be logged on as
super.super to perform this action. Upon initiating the action, you are prompted to enter the IPv4
address of the UPS.
